    I wish I could. I have plans this weekend, and next weekend.

    I usually park at Mutual Mine Recreational area, hike the 12 mile route to the campsite in D loop, then do the 8 mile return route to my truck.

    However, I've gone out there 3 times solo, and never been alone at the campsites. Kind of like on the AT, hiking may be solitary but camping usually ends up with a group... it's fun meeting new people. Hikers are usually great people.

    Have fun.

    P.S. There is a water source near the campsite on D loop, but it's milky looking (lime stone?) ... it's easy to cache a gallon of water on the trail near the parking area less than a mile from the campsite - before you park and start your hike.

    Back at it next Wednesday (4-20-16) for an overnighter on the citrus tract .
    Giving A bit more notice this week.
    I will be staying at youngblood campground(three mile hike from tillis hill rec area) and spending a overnight then hiking the south west section of the D loop to taylor campground and to where trail crosses hwy 480 .
    Roughly A 16 mile hike for thursday.
